Is keam is sufficient to become aeronautical engineer in iist thiruvananthapuram?

Sorry, but KEAM is not sufficient to get admission in IIST Thiruvananthapuram. You need to qualify JEE Advanced to get admission here. The reason is that IIST is a central government funded University. So, clearing JEE Advanced is the only way to get into the BTech program in Aerospace Engineering in IIST. You need to score at least 20% in JEE Advanced (minimum 72 marks out of 360) and have atleast 6 marks in each of the individual subjects.
